Cape Meares
Cape Meares has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$26,346. Population has grown 45% since 2009. 36%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 24%. Median home value is $288,500. With a median age of 57.0, the population is older than the US median of 35.2. Households here earn about 36% less than the Oregon median.

How many people live in Cape Meares, Oregon?
Cape Meares, Oregon has about 110 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in Cape Meares, Oregon?
The typical household in Cape Meares, Oregon earns about $26,346 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Cape Meares, Oregon expensive?
In Cape Meares, Oregon, the median home is worth about $288,500, and the typical rent is about $950 a month.
How educated are people in Cape Meares, Oregon?
About 36.4% of adults age 25 and over in Cape Meares, Oregon h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Cape Meares, Oregon?
About 30.6% of people in Cape Meares, Oregon live below the federal poverty line.
